Yet, in one way, Alvarez has already far surpassed Pacquiao. Despite his youth and with few recognizable names on his record, Alvarez is already a top draw and moving up quickly. Pacquiao is the biggest drawing card in the sport, but that wasn’t the case when he made his U.S. debut in 2001 by fighting Lehlo Ledwaba on an Oscar De La Hoya undercard at the MGM Grand Garden in Las Vegas.By that time, Pacquiao was 22 and already an established superstar in the Philippines. He was, however, a virtual unknown in the U.S.It took Pacquiao several years, a number of promotional and managerial changes and a slew of big wins for him to become the worldwide icon he is today. Alvarez doesn’t have nearly Pacquiao’s resume in the ring, but he’s so popular outside of it, he’s treated with the kind of reverence it took Pacquiao years of toil in the U.S. to earn. There may be a day when it is not laughable to compare Saul “Canelo” Alvarez to Manny Pacquiao. That day, most assuredly, is not remotely near.Pacquiao is the top pound-for-pound boxer in the world and one of the most accomplished fighters of all time. He’ll be inducted into the International Boxing Hall of Fame regardless of whether he wins another bout. Alvarez is a 20-year-old who has already won a world title, but he hasn’t faced nearly the kind of competition that would convince a neutral observer that he’s going to be an elite fighter.
